Study of a new polymer heart valve for mitral or aortic replacement

AORTIC VALVE DISEASESMitral Valve DiseaseAortic StenosisAortic RegurgitationMitral StenosisMitral Regurgitation

Part of Heart & circulation clinical trials.

This study tests a new type of prosthetic heart valve made from a special polymer material. It is for adults who need surgical replacement of either the mitral or aortic valve.

Who can take part

  • You are an adult who needs surgery to replace either your mitral valve or aortic valve.
  • You must be well enough to undergo open-heart surgery with a heart-lung machine (cardiopulmonary bypass).
  • You should be able to safely take blood-thinning medication (anticoagulation therapy).
  • You must understand the study goals, agree to participate, and be willing to come back for follow-up visits.
